Laetitia Bader, Human Rights Watch (HRW)-Somalia researcher, speaks at a press conference in the Kenyan capital, Nairobi, on September 8, 2014 during the launch of a HRW report on sexual exploitation and abuse by AU forces in Somalia. Internationally-funded African Union troops in war-torn and impoverished Somalia have raped women and girls as young as 12 and traded food aid for sex, Human Rights Watch said in a damning report. "Some of the women who were raped said that the soldiers gave them food or money afterwards in an apparent attempt to frame the assault as transactional sex," the HRW report said.
